Least Common Multiple of 57488 and 57502 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 57488 and 57502, than apply into the LCM equation.

GCF(57488,57502) = 2
LCM(57488,57502) = ( 57488 × 57502) / 2
LCM(57488,57502) = 3305674976 / 2
LCM(57488,57502) = 1652837488
